What happened
The landlord applied for an order to terminate the tenancy and evict the tenants because they have been persistently late in paying their rent. The landlord also claimed compensation for each day the tenants remained in the unit after the termination date.
The ruling
The tenancy is terminated, and the tenants must move out by August 15, 2020. The tenants shall pay the landlord $8,494.30, which represents compensation for the use of the unit from December 1, 2019 to August 4, 2020, less the rent deposit and interest the landlord owes on the rent deposit. The tenants shall also pay the landlord $39.13 per day for compensation for the use of the unit from August 5, 2020 to the date they move out, and $175.00 for the cost of filing the application. If the tenants do not pay the full amount by August 15, 2020, they will start to owe interest at 2.00% annually on the outstanding balance.
